Gene Tunney Elliott
May 27, 1929 - October 19, 2021
Gene Tunney Elliott, 92, of Lake Panasoffkee, Florida passed away in Bushnell, Florida on October 19, 2021. He was born in Salisbury, Maryland on May 27, 1929 to Irving and Mary Elliott. He was a member of the United Methodist Church of Lake Panasoffkee. He retired from military service after serving 20 years as a Master Sargent in the Marines. He served in the Vietnam and Korean Wars. He was a member of the Masons of Bushnell Lodge 30, Odd Fellows Lodge #58 in Leesburg, Rebekahs Lodge 52, Sanford #5 Patriarch Militant, Lodge #17 The Grand Encampment, Veterans of Foreign Wars # 10084, American Legion #101, Korean War Veterans Lodge #169 of Leesburg, and Marine Corp League #1240 Lake County. He enjoyed traveling, reading, and being active in his community.
